7 Participation Constraint
Indicates whether existence of entity depends on its being related to another entity via a relationship set. Total participation constraint (existence dependency) – Every dependent entity must be related to an entity in the entity set on which it is dependent. Partial participation constraint – Some of the dependent entities are related to entities in the other entity set. 7

8 Example of Total Participation
FName DName MainOffice SSN Office Faculty WorksFor Department Participation constraint: Each faculty member must work for some (i.e., at least one) department. A faculty entity cannot exist without being assigned to a department. Key constraint: Each faculty member may work for at most one department. 8
